Indian Super League approves 3+1 foreigners regulation for 2021/22 season!

The Indian Super League on Monday, July 6 approved the 3+1 foreigners regulation for matches from the 2021/22 season, bringing it down from the existing five to boost “increased participation” of local Indian players. TRAU FC sign Naresh Singh from Jamshedpur FC!

I-League side Tiddim Road Athletic Union (TRAU) FC have announced the signing of defender Naresh Singh from ISL side Jamshedpur FC. 22 year old Manipur-born Naresh Singh Yendrembam played football locally before joining the renowned Tata Football Academy.
